Compare all specifications:
1993 Chrysler Viper | 2012 BMW 325 | |
Make | Chrysler | BMW |
Model | Viper | 325 |
Year Released | 1993 | 2012 |
Body Type | Roadster | Coupe |
Engine Position | Front | Front |
Engine Size | 7985 cc | 1995 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 10 cylinders | 4 cylinders |
Engine Type | V | in-line |
Valves per Cylinder | 2 valves | 4 valves |
Horse Power | 389 HP | 217 HP |
Engine RPM | 5150 RPM | 4400 RPM |
Torque | 620 Nm | 450 Nm |
Torque RPM | 3600 RPM | 2500 RPM |
Fuel Type | Gasoline | Diesel |
Drive Type | Rear | Rear |
Transmission Type | Manual | 6-speed manual |
Number of Seats | 2 seats | 5 seats |
Number of Doors | 2 doors | 2 doors |
Vehicle Length | 4460 mm | 4624 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1930 mm | 1811 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1130 mm | 1384 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 2450 mm | 2810 mm |
